After 16 years as a group, 3 Inches of Blood have announced their plans to split. The Canadian metal outfit however wanted to get in one final show to say goodbye to their fans and they've booked a Nov. 7 show at the Commodore Ballroom in their hometown of Vancouver.

The group offered a lengthy statement on the matter, explaining, "While our reasons are personal, just know we are all still good friends, but it is just time to move on. All of us will continue to pursue musical projects, so refer to our social media pages to keep up with that." 3 Inches of Blood formed in 1999, but have had a string of lineup changes over the years. The longest tenured member is clean vocalist Cam Pipes, who started his run with the band in 2001. Guitarists Shane Clark and Justin Hagberg have been with the band since 2004 and drummer Ash Pearson joined in 2007.

During their time together, 3 Inches of Blood released five studio albums -- Battlecry Under a Wintersun, Advance and Vanquish, Fire Up the Blades, Here Waits Thy Doom and Long Live Heavy Metal.
